Local guide

Eldora's elevation (9,200–10,600 ft) and Front Range exposure means snow can be wind-affected, especially on Corona Bowl. The trees and lower-mountain runs hold snow quality best. Storm tracks from the west deliver Eldora's biggest dumps — easterly upslopes can pile fresh snow on the foothills.

All blues and most blacks groomed nightly. Corona Bowl, glades, and tree runs left natural.
